Cargill, Incorporated

Cargill, Incorporated

Cargill, the largest privately held corporation in the United States, moves more agricultural commodities than any other company on earth. Headquartered in Wayzata, Minnesota, the 1865-founded family enterprise reported US$164 billion in fiscal 2026 revenue, rebounding from US$154 billion a year earlier, with roughly 155,000 employees operating in 70 countries and selling into 125 markets. Its grip spans the full chain - grain origination, ocean freight, soybean crushing, animal nutrition, and meat processing - and it is the single largest supply partner to…

Wilmar International Limited

Wilmar International Limited

Wilmar International Limited, founded in 1991 and headquartered in Singapore, is Asia's leading agribusiness group and the world's largest palm-oil refiner and processor. The SGX-listed company generated over US$67 billion in 2025 revenue, employs about 100,000 people, and operates 1,000+ manufacturing plants across more than 50 countries. Through its Chinese subsidiary Yihai Kerry (Arawana), Wilmar controls roughly RMB 220 billion of China cooking-oil and grain sales, making it the undisputed leader in the world's largest edible-oil market…

Archer Daniels Midland Company ( ADM )

Archer Daniels Midland Company (ADM)

Archer-Daniels-Midland Company (ADM), founded in 1902 and headquartered in Chicago, is one of the world's four "ABCD" grain majors and a leader in agricultural processing and nutrition. The NYSE-listed group generated US$85.5 billion in 2025 revenue with roughly 41,500 employees serving 160+ countries through 250 manufacturing plants and 500 grain elevators. ADM's franchise spans grain merchandising, oilseed crushing, carbohydrate solutions, animal nutrition, and human nutrition - turning corn, soybeans and wheat into everything from sweeteners to plant-bas…

Bunge Limited

Bunge Limited

Bunge Global SA, founded in 1818 and headquartered in Chesterfield, Missouri (with Swiss registration), is the world's largest oilseed processor and a top-tier player in vegetable oils, specialty fats and grain merchandising. Following its landmark US$11.5 billion merger with Viterra completed in July 2025, the combined group reached about US$91.8 billion in trailing-twelve-month revenue, operates 300+ processing facilities and deepwater terminals across 50+ countries, and employs roughly 22,000-34,000 people. China Oil and Foodstuffs Corporation ( COFCO )

China Oil and Foodstuffs Corporation ( COFCO )

COFCO Corporation is China's largest state-owned grain, oil and food enterprise, headquartered in Beijing and created in 1949. The centrally-administered SOE reported US$88.26 billion in 2025 revenue (about RMB 630 billion), employs roughly 106,000-120,000 people, and operates 360+ processing plants and 500+ warehousing facilities spanning 140+ countries - making it one of the four or five most powerful food-security platforms on the planet. Its branded portfolio includes Fortune cooking oil, Joycome pork, and a controlling stake in dairy giant Mengniu.…

What is the Edible Oils and Fats Industry, and what products does it include ?
The edible oils and fats industry encompasses the processing, production, and distribution of fats and oils derived from plants, animals, and marine sources for human consumption and industrial use. It's a vast global sector that goes far beyond the cooking oils in your kitchen. Products range from household staples like soybean and olive oil to industrial frying fats for food service, specialty nutritional oils (e.g., fish oil, flaxseed oil), and functional ingredients like lecithin and MCT oil used in everything from chocolate to infant formula and cosmetics.
How do I choose the right cooking oil for different methods like frying, baking, or salads ?
Selecting the right oil depends on its "smoke point"—the temperature at which it starts to smoke and break down. For high-heat methods like deep-frying or searing, use oils with high smoke points, such as avocado, rice bran, or refined canola oil. For medium-heat sautéing or baking, olive oil or coconut oil are good choices. For salad dressings or low-heat dishes, delicate oils like extra virgin olive oil, walnut oil, or flaxseed oil are ideal to preserve their flavor and nutritional properties. Always match the oil to your cooking temperature.
What are Specialty Nutritional Oils and Functional Fats, and how are they used ?
Specialty Nutritional Oils (e.g., evening primrose, borage, flaxseed oil) are valued for their unique fatty acid profiles, like high levels of Gamma-Linolenic Acid (GLA) or Omega-3s, and are often consumed as dietary supplements for targeted health benefits. Functional Fats are engineered or specially processed ingredients designed for specific uses in food manufacturing. Examples include MCT Oil for rapid energy, Structured Lipids for improved fat absorption, and Fat Replacers to reduce calorie content in foods. They are key components in sports nutrition, medical foods, and healthy formulated products.
How do Industrial Specialty Fats differ from the cooking oils I use at home ?
Industrial specialty fats are formulated for performance and consistency in large-scale food manufacturing and food service, not for retail consumer flavor. They include frying oils that resist breakdown for longer fry life, shortenings and margarines designed for specific pastry textures, and cocoa butter equivalents for chocolate production. Unlike many household oils, they may be hydrogenated or fractionated for specific melting points and stability. Their focus is on functionality, cost-effectiveness, and ensuring the final processed food product has the desired quality and shelf-life.
What are the key future trends shaping the edible oils and fats industry ?
The industry is being shaped by several key trends: 1. Health & Wellness: Demand is soaring for oils perceived as healthier, like high-oleic varieties, avocado oil, and oils with beneficial fatty acid profiles. 2. Sustainability: Traceability, deforestation-free pledges (especially for palm oil), and the rise of eco-innovative oils from algae or insects are critical. 3. Functionality: Growth in MCT oils and tailored fats for sports nutrition, clinical diets, and plant-based alternatives. 4. Transparency: Consumers and manufacturers increasingly demand clear information on sourcing and processing.
